1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is Work Study?
Back
A program that allows students to earn money through part-time work to help pay for their college expenses.
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is Savings in the context of paying for college?
Back
Money that is set aside in a bank account to be used for future expenses, such as tuition.

3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is a Scholarship?
Back
Money awarded to students based on achievement that does not have to be repaid.

4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is a Grant?
Back
Financial aid awarded to students that does not have to be repaid, often based on financial need.

5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is a Loan?
Back
Money borrowed that must be repaid with interest, often used to pay for college expenses.
